Transaction 98b9929d524371f9f46fb0b0f47b46975a0661af644a83eb43fb409c95bfe986

2 Input
1 Outputs
  • 98b9929d524371f9f46fb0b0f47b46975a0661af644a83eb43fb409c95bfe986:0
  • value  149999648
    address  32wPcaHaFiniMsrFuVdLkrvF5wZAKSeitF